Key Policies for Obituary Submissions
Pioneer Press adheres to certain policies to ensure the integrity and accuracy of published obituaries. Understanding these policies will help streamline the submission process.
Verification of Death
To maintain the authenticity of obituary announcements, Pioneer Press requires verification of death. You will need to provide either:
- Funeral Home/Cremation Society Information: The name and phone number of the funeral home or cremation society handling the arrangements. Pioneer Press will contact them during business hours to verify the passing.
- University of Minnesota Anatomy Bequest Program (or similar): If the deceased’s body was donated to a program like the University of Minnesota Anatomy Bequest Program, their phone number is required for verification.
- Death Certificate: A death certificate is also accepted as proof of death. Only one of these verification methods is necessary.
Please allow sufficient time for verification, especially during weekend hours when funeral homes may have limited availability.
Guestbooks and Outside Websites
Pioneer Press policy restricts referencing external media sources that host guestbooks or obituaries. However, you can include a funeral home website or a family email address for contact purposes within the obituary. If you have questions regarding this policy, please contact the obituary desk for clarification.

Payment Information
Pre-payment is required for all obituary notices before publication. Payment must be made by the specified deadline in the deadline schedule.
Rates
Understanding the rate structure will help you plan for the cost of the obituary.
- Minimum Charge: The minimum charge for an obituary is $162 for the first 10 lines.
- Cost Per Line (After 10 Lines): Each line after the initial 10 lines is charged at $12.20.
- Obituaries Under 10 Lines: Even if the obituary is shorter than 10 lines, the minimum charge of $162 applies.
- Second Run Date Line Rate: For obituaries running for a second day, the line rate is $8.20 per line, starting from the first line.
- Photo Charge: Each photo published is $125 per day. For example, publishing two photos for two days would incur four photo charges, totaling $500.
